My story

Ms Mary Monroe is a smart, sweet, active dog who would thrive as an agility or trick dog! She is super friendly with everyone she meets and thrives on canine enrichment games like fetch and dog puzzles. She’s about 1 year old, about 13 lb, and we think she’s a Jack Russel Chihuahua mix.  She has adjusted very well during her time in the Lower East Side of Manhattan and loves to go on adventures, though is still nervous of big trucks and loud noises. Mary’s very favorite fun time is when she’s let off leash at a private community garden, alone or playing with her foster siblings. She loves playing chase and running and can hurdle over a bench! She is obedient and comes back when called. Mary loves making friends with new people and pooches. She is learning “sit” and working on other obedience training.  Ms Monroe has an incredibly sweet disposition. She is outgoing and friendly without being pushy. She takes treats gently from both known folks and strangers she meets. She’s also great with other dogs and shares space and toys nicely. She also enjoys snuggling on the sofa, sleeps in bed with her foster human and her dogs amicably.  Mary is smart and making fast improvement with positive reinforcement. She is working on housetraining both on pee pads and outside and is almost there, as well as basic commands.  Her adoptive family will need to continue working with Mary to reinforce and advance the progress she's been making in leash walking. She hasn’t had any separation anxiety when left alone with lots of cognitive toys and things like kongs to keep her occupied. Mary is an exceptional little girl who is going to make a wonderful addition to some lucky family! Vaccinated for rabies, DHPP, and bordetella. Neutered and microchipped.
